The nervous system is the control center of our body. It reacts to external stimuli, regulates breathing, heartbeat, hormones, and our stress responses. In hectic times, it can easily become overloaded – the consequences: tension, sleep problems, restlessness, or emotional exhaustion.
Aromatherapy offers a gentle way to support the nervous system. Essential oils act directly on the limbic system, which controls our emotions, memories, and stress responses. Just a few deep breaths with the right scent can calm the nervous system and promote a sense of balance.
Calming Oils: Lavender, Chamomile, Sandalwood
• Reduce stress
• Help you fall asleep
• Promote relaxation

Practical application:
• A roll-on on wrists or neck
• A fragrance diffuser at work or at home
• A few drops in a warm foot bath
Regular small rituals are often more effective than occasional, large applications. The nervous system learns to respond to rest and can regenerate more effectively. Aromatherapy does not replace medical treatment, but it can be a powerful tool for daily well-being.
